COLLECTOR OF CUSTOMS VS Ms. SHAZIA AMAN Ss.25-a, 194-a(1) & 196---Customs Rules, 2001, R.107(a)---Valuation Ruling, applicability of---appeal---Limitation---authorities were aggrieved of order passed by Customs appellate Tribunal on the plea that appeal was barred by limitation---Validity---Valuation ruling applied by authorities was not applicable as valuation was to be issued on the basis of data of 90 days either before or after, import in terms of R.107(a) of Customs Rules, 2001---Exact dates of clearance of goods were not disclosed---In absence of clear date of clearance of goods, applicability of Valuation Ruling of 15-07-2009 and 27-07-2010 were farfetched---Provision of S.25-a of Customs act, 1969, was amended by Finance act, 2010 and assented on 30-06-2010, which was subsequent to the last ruling relied upon---By the time goods were cleared, the regime of availability of 90% data pre or post, was applicable as applicability of last issued Valuation Ruling was introduced after 30-06-2010---Even show-cause notice was silent as to the date of clearance of goods---High Court declined to interfere in the order passed by Customs appellate Tribunal---Reference was dismissed, in circumstances.
